Transaction 068789a00d6e39a0b5061437c8e584e1077cec9f76dbc78a271c7f3fabef1403

1 Input
2 Outputs
  • 068789a00d6e39a0b5061437c8e584e1077cec9f76dbc78a271c7f3fabef1403:0
  • value  477673673
    address  18ZH7RWY7aDCaHHZkiibduqUm3nQnThz3f
  • 068789a00d6e39a0b5061437c8e584e1077cec9f76dbc78a271c7f3fabef1403:1
  • value  4625062
    address  1J5bXKShCiaWoCDM7cmmKH13dwXqJxoKi1